Job Duties, these are considered essential to the successful performance of this position:

  • Conduct SBIRT (screening, brief intervention, and referral to treatment) services to patients either in person or via telehealth.
  • Perform triage assessments and provide psychoeducation to patients referred to behavioral health services or experiencing a crisis.
  • Perform crisis intervention services including, but not limited to de-escalation, assessing for safety, brief counseling and psychosocial interventions, determining and referring to appropriate level of care
  • Collaborate with interdisciplinary team regarding patient care
  • Provide education to staff and providers regarding mental health and substance use disorders
  • Assist with coordinating internal and external behavioral health referrals, collaborate with referral agencies and resources as needed.
  • Provide short-term case management and connect patients with community resources.
